    Mesa Stiletto is my fav amp. I have Owned all 3 versions, still have a Stage 2 head and Ace combo. The Ace is closest to the “Marshall sound”. Any tonal discrepancies can be fixed with a decent EQ before and/or after the preamp section. I use a 4CM setup with an axe Fx and can get my stilettos to sound like Hendrix & Page to nearly like a Mark ala Petrucci.
    Still like the Stiletto over the Marshall due to master volume, excellent series loop, and 2 channels with full tonal controls plus 3 modes each. And let’s not forget about the Diode/Tube rectifier and Bold:Spongy settings for modern or classic old school vibe…No Marshall I know of has these options and I use them all from time to time depending on what is require

    The Nomads are probably the most hated, also the Heartbreaker and the S.O.B. Is up there too. Stiletto is awesome. Have had my Deuce II for 15 years. Definitely need to make sure you get a series II, not a series I. They dialed in CH2 much better on the II. Graphic EQ in the loop can do some great things. The louder it is the more the EQ will balance out on brightness. But at low volumes all you have to do is keep the treble and presence really low.
